Embodiment 2

[0039] The preparation of embodiment 2 hydroxypropyl chitin / tannic acid / ferric chloride HPCH / TA / Fe hydrogel

[0040] The thermosensitive hydroxypropyl chitin HPCH, tannic acid TA and ferric chloride hexahydrate FeCl prepared in embodiment 1 3 ·6H 2 O is dissolved in ultrapure water at a low temperature of 2-14°C, and a HPCH solution with a mass concentration of 3wt%, a TA solution of 0.75wt% and a FeCl of 0.8wt% are prepared 3 ·6H 2 O solution. Take 1g of HPCH solution and add 0.4g of TA solution at a low temperature of 2-14°C and quickly vortex to mix evenly, then quickly add 0.1g of FeCl 3 Vortex and mix the solution at a low temperature of 2-14°C, and adjust the pH to 7.4 with 1M NaOH solution. The neutral solution containing tannic acid has good fluidity at a low temperature of 2-14°C, and can be injected or sprayed. Stand in a water bath at 37°C for 1 min to form a hydrogel ( figure 1 ).

Abstract

The invention provides an injectable temperature-sensitive compound antibacterial hydrogel material containing tannin and a preparing method and application of the compound antibacterial hydrogel material. The material has temperature sensitivity and pH sensitivity, can be injected in situ or sprayed, and can be used as an antibacterial dressing. Firstly, a temperature-sensitive polyhydroxyl-containing polymer such as a chitin derivative is dissolved in water at low temperature, a tannin solution and a metal ion solution are added in a liquid state for uniform mixing, then the compound antibacterial hydrogel material is injected or sprayed on the surface of a wound, and gel can be quickly formed at the body temperature, wherein the tannin is regarded as a cross-linking agent, and also chelated with metal ions to serve an antibacterial agent capable of being slowly released. The antibacterial hydrogel dressing mainly has the advantages that the preparation is simple, the low-temperaturefluidity is good, the gel is quickly formed at the body temperature, the antibacterial agent can be slowly released, the antibacterial range is wide, and the antibacterial time is long; the compoundantibacterial hydrogel material has good biocompatibility and biodegradability, and secondary injuries triggered during dressing changing are avoided; wound healing is facilitated, skin regeneration is effectively promoted, the formation of scars is reduced, and the injectable temperature-sensitive compound antibacterial hydrogel material also has the anti-inflammatory and anti-oxidation effects.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of biomedical materials and their preparation, and relates to an injectable temperature-sensitive composite antibacterial hydrogel material containing tannic acid and its preparation and application. Background technique [0002] The skin is composed of stratum corneum, epidermis and dermis, and is the basic barrier to protect internal tissues, prevent pathogens from invading, and maintain body fluid balance. However, wounds such as cuts, contusions, cuts, and burns can impair the function of the skin, causing bacterial infections, excessive loss of protein and water, endocrine and immune system disorders, and other problems.
